You must be one charming/witty/engaging person for you to think this way. Otherwise, it's just pure cope.Depends on what you mean by "lost cause". Do I have skills, capacity, and social intelligence to fit in with any social group? Absolutely I do. Do I *want * to fit in with just any random social group? Not a chance.
Social encounters have to pass the same cost-benefit analysis as any other investment decision. I will put in whatever social effort needed to get whatever return back I hope to attain. If I foresee poor odds of return, I invest (or rather not) accordingly. I can roughly estimate who's going to bring what social return (positive or negative) to the table, and move to increase or decrease contact accordingly.
I don't consider this anti-social either. I call it being selective. As an introvert with limited social fuel reserves, it's in my best interest to be selective and allocate wisely with whom to interact with, engage with, respond to, to obtain the most probable best social outcomes possible. I have to, not only is time finite, but the quality of life is too easily raised or lowered via these social engagements.
Should my end game be to maximize peace, love and happiness in this world to achieve highest quality of life (which it is), then it stands to reason I ensure my social investment decisions are driven with that end game in mind (which it is).
And yeah, I hear you on missing having a best friend. I miss it also.
